What is SSH?
Alright, let’s break it down. SSH, or Secure Shell, is basically like a superhero for your internet connections. It’s a network protocol that allows you to securely access and manage remote devices over an unsecured network. Think of it as a secret tunnel that keeps your data safe from prying eyes.
SSH isn’t just about security, though. It also gives you full control over your devices, which is super handy when you’re dealing with IoT gadgets. Whether you’re managing a smart thermostat or monitoring security cameras, SSH makes sure your commands reach the device without any interference.

Setting Up SSH for IoT Devices
Alright, let’s get practical. Setting up SSH for your IoT devices isn’t as hard as it sounds. Here’s a step-by-step guide to help you get started:
- Install SSH on Your Device: Most IoT devices come with SSH pre-installed, but if yours doesn’t, you’ll need to install it manually. Check the manufacturer’s website for instructions.
- Generate SSH Keys: SSH keys are like digital passwords that allow you to securely connect to your device. You can generate them using tools like PuTTY or OpenSSH.
- Set Up Port Forwarding: To access your device remotely, you’ll need to set up port forwarding on your router. This allows traffic to reach your device even when you’re not on the same network.
- Test Your Connection: Once everything is set up, test your connection to make sure it’s working properly. You can do this by connecting to your device from another computer or smartphone.
And there you have it—your very own SSH connection for IoT devices. It might take a bit of tinkering, but once you get the hang of it, it’s a breeze.

Common Security Threats
Here are a few common security threats to watch out for:
- Brute Force Attacks: Hackers use automated tools to guess your passwords. Strong passwords and two-factor authentication can help prevent these attacks.
- Man-in-the-Middle Attacks: These occur when a hacker intercepts your communication between devices. Using SSH encrypts your data, making it much harder for attackers to snoop.
Stay informed about these threats and take steps to protect your devices. Your IoT setup is only as secure as your weakest link, so don’t take any chances.
Common Issues and How to Fix Them
Even the best-laid plans can run into issues. Here are a few common problems you might encounter when setting up SSH for IoT, along with solutions:
- Connection Refused: This usually happens when your SSH server isn’t running or your port forwarding isn’t set up correctly. Check your server settings and router configuration to fix the issue.
- Authentication Failed: If you’re getting authentication errors, double-check your SSH keys and make sure they’re correctly configured on both your device and client.
Don’t get discouraged if you run into problems. SSH can be a bit finicky at times, but with a bit of troubleshooting, you can get it working smoothly.
Tools and Software for SSH IoT
There are plenty of tools and software out there to help you manage your SSH connections for IoT. Here are a few of the best ones:
- PuTTY: A popular SSH client for Windows users, PuTTY is simple to use and packed with features.
- OpenSSH: If you’re using Linux or macOS, OpenSSH is already installed on your system. It’s a powerful tool for managing SSH connections.
- Termius: A cross-platform SSH client that works on both desktop and mobile devices, Termius is a great choice for managing multiple SSH connections.
These tools can make your life a lot easier when it comes to managing SSH connections for IoT devices. Experiment with them to find the one that works best for you.
